Definition and Importance of Explicit Instruction
Explicit instruction is a systematic and purposeful teaching approach that emphasizes clarity and directness․ It involves clearly explaining concepts‚ modeling tasks‚ and guiding students through structured learning experiences․ This method ensures that all learners‚ regardless of their background‚ can access the curriculum effectively․ Explicit instruction is particularly beneficial for students who may struggle with abstract concepts or lack prerequisite skills․ By breaking down complex skills into manageable parts and providing scaffolded support‚ teachers can promote academic equity and ensure that no student is left behind․ Research highlights its effectiveness in accelerating learning outcomes‚ making it a cornerstone of effective pedagogy․ Its structured nature also fosters a supportive learning environment‚ enabling teachers to monitor progress and provide timely feedback․

Review of Relevant Information
A review of relevant information is essential to connect new content with students’ prior knowledge․ This step ensures learners can build on existing skills and concepts‚ making instruction more effective․ Teachers often discuss previous lessons or real-world examples to activate background knowledge․ This element helps students see relationships between old and new information‚ reducing confusion․ It also allows educators to clarify misunderstandings early on․ By linking new material to familiar ideas‚ teachers create a solid foundation for learning․ This strategic approach ensures students are well-prepared to engage with upcoming content․ Reviewing relevant information is a cornerstone of explicit instruction‚ fostering a clear and focused learning environment․
Verification of Prerequisite Skills
Verification of prerequisite skills ensures students possess the necessary knowledge and abilities to grasp new content․ Teachers assess prior learning to identify gaps and provide targeted support․ This step prevents misconceptions and ensures a smooth transition to new material․ By confirming foundational skills‚ educators tailor instruction to meet student needs effectively․ Regular checks help maintain academic progress and confidence․ This element is crucial for building a strong learning foundation and ensuring all students can engage with upcoming lessons successfully․ It aligns instruction with student readiness‚ promoting equitable learning opportunities․ Verification of skills is a proactive approach to teaching‚ enhancing overall classroom effectiveness and student outcomes․

Breaking Down Complex Skills into Smaller Units
Breaking complex skills into smaller units is essential for effective learning․ Teachers identify key components‚ ensuring each step is manageable and builds logically․ This approach prevents overwhelm‚ allowing students to master one concept before moving to the next․ By structuring lessons this way‚ teachers can address individual needs and provide targeted support․ Students benefit from clear‚ incremental progress‚ which enhances understanding and retention․ This method is particularly beneficial for learners who may struggle with abstract concepts‚ as it provides a scaffolded pathway to mastery․ Regular review and practice of each unit reinforce learning and prepare students for more complex tasks ahead․
Scaffolding Techniques for Effective Learning
Scaffolding involves providing temporary support to help students connect new information to their existing knowledge․ This technique is vital for bridging learning gaps and ensuring understanding․ Teachers use scaffolding to gradually release responsibility to students as they gain confidence and proficiency․ Techniques include modeling‚ guided practice‚ and the use of visual aids or graphic organizers․ Scaffolding also involves breaking tasks into manageable steps and offering prompts or cues to guide student thinking․ By tailoring support to individual needs‚ scaffolding ensures that all learners can access the curriculum and achieve success․ This approach fosters independence and encourages active participation‚ making it a cornerstone of effective explicit instruction․
Modeling and Demonstration Strategies
Modeling and demonstration are critical strategies in explicit instruction‚ allowing teachers to clearly show students how to perform tasks or solve problems․ By providing live‚ concrete examples‚ educators help learners understand complex skills and processes․ Teachers often “think aloud” during demonstrations‚ revealing their decision-making and problem-solving strategies․ This approach makes abstract concepts more tangible and accessible․ Visual aids‚ such as diagrams or step-by-step guides‚ complement live demonstrations‚ reinforcing learning․ Modeling also helps students see the expected outcomes and understand the steps required to achieve them․ By observing demonstrations‚ students gain clarity and confidence‚ reducing confusion and misinterpretation․ This strategy is particularly effective when combined with guided practice‚ enabling students to transition from observation to application seamlessly․

Guided Practice to Reinforce Learning
Guided practice is a critical component of explicit instruction‚ allowing students to apply skills under teacher supervision․ This step follows modeling and demonstration‚ providing opportunities for students to practice tasks with support․ Teachers actively engage with students‚ offering feedback and clarification to address misunderstandings․ Guided practice helps build confidence and fluency‚ ensuring students grasp key concepts before moving to independent work․ It is structured to gradually release responsibility‚ fostering a smooth transition from teacher-led instruction to student autonomy․ By incorporating scaffolding techniques‚ educators ensure that learners receive the necessary support to succeed‚ making guided practice an essential bridge between demonstration and mastery․
Independent Practice for Mastery
Independent practice is the final stage of explicit instruction‚ where students apply learned skills without teacher guidance․ This phase reinforces mastery by allowing students to work autonomously‚ solidifying their understanding and fluency․ Tasks are designed to mirror real-world applications‚ ensuring relevance and engagement․ Teachers monitor progress to identify any remaining gaps‚ providing targeted support as needed․ Independent practice builds confidence and self-reliance‚ preparing students for future challenges․ It is a crucial step in ensuring long-term retention and the ability to apply skills across various contexts․ By giving students the opportunity to work independently‚ educators empower them to take ownership of their learning‚ fostering a sense of accomplishment and readiness for advanced instruction․

Providing Constructive Feedback
Providing constructive feedback is essential for student growth‚ as it clarifies strengths and areas for improvement․ Feedback should be clear‚ specific‚ and actionable‚ guiding students on how to refine their work․ Teachers should focus on the task rather than the student‚ using positive language to encourage motivation․ Timely feedback is crucial‚ as it helps students make adjustments while the learning is fresh․ This practice reinforces learning goals and helps students understand expectations․ Constructive feedback also fosters a growth mindset‚ showing students that effort and revision lead to mastery․ By providing detailed insights‚ teachers empower students to take ownership of their learning and make measurable progress toward their academic goals․
